Clinic Financial Resource Guide
**Overview** M Health Fairview's Ambulatory Care Coordination Team has an immediate opening for a Financial Resource Worker. This is a 1.0 FTE (80 hours per two week pay period) opening. This role is based out of the Midway Corporate Campus in St. Paul. **Responsibilities Job Description** The Financial Resource Workers (FRW) assist patients in successfully understanding and applying for health insurance and various other financially related programs including County Benefits (SNAP, cash assistance and Emergency Assistance), Energy Assistance and Charity Care. This assistance is provided both telephonically and on site at all M Health Fairview Clinics. Duties Include: + Maintains knowledge of, and complies with, all relevant laws, regulations, policies, procedures and + Work with Care Management team to assist patients in obtaining and maintaining health care insurance/coverage and applying for financial assistance programs. + Provides financial assessments for uninsured patients and patients who are experiencing financial hardship. + Meets with patients over the phone to assist with applications, including but not limited to, Medical Assistance, MNCare, Qualified Health Plans through MNsure open enrollment, the Combined Application for County Benefits, Emergency Assistance and Charity Care. + Works actively with patients to fill out forms and ensure all necessary information is included in and during the application process. + Advocates for patients in dealing with government + Collaborates with various M Health Fairview departments, community organizations, county and state agencies to meet patient needs. **Qualifications** **Required** **Education** High school graduate or equivalent Knowledge of government and federal assistance **Experience** 1 -2 years of financial counseling experience required Ability to work with patients from differing socioeconomic backgrounds, language barriers and cultures in a way that is comprehendible. **License/Certification/Registration** MNSure Certification is required within 60 days of hire- training and certification maintenance part of on-going employment. **Preferred** **Education** MNSure Certification Knowledge of insurance application process through local MN and WI counties **Experience** MN Sure Navigator experience both in person and telephonically 1 -2 years of experience in a clinic setting preferred EPCI electronic medical record knowledge and documentation **License/Certification/Registration** MNSURE Certification **Other Skills We Desire:** Knowledge of third party payers, billing procedures and insurance. Ability to work independently and exercise independent judgment. Excellent customer service, public relations and communication skills Ability to prioritize and work with a fluctuation in workload while working independently Ability to adapt to change and engage in ongoing process improvement Flexibility to work at other sites is encouraged We are an equal opportunity employer and value diversity at our company.
